![]() ![]()
There also appears a floating button with play/pause, restart, and stop at the top center in VS Code. The bottom blue bar color in VS Code turns to orange after the debugger is attached to your app. The terminal prints some lines along with Debugger Attached. You can then continue with the debugging process below.įor more on using nodemon and VS Code, click here. Edit and save your app to see nodemon in action. If you are using Windows, npm i -g nodemon should work. #Visual studio code js debugger install#Try using this: sudo npm install -g -force nodemon, which worked in my case. If you get this error: nodemon: command not found, it means nodemon was not installed properly. You can then launch your app normally, replacing node with nodemon. Then add the following under configurations in your launch.json. You can install it via npm using npm i nodemon. Nodemon is a tool that auto-reloads the server and reattaches the debugger after you make changes to your app. ![]() You can also start the debugger by pressing F5. Then run the app in a terminal using the -inspect flag like this node -inspect. #Visual studio code js debugger how to#(Learn more about the different options available here.) The configurations tell VS Code how to handle debugging. You can add more configurations via the floating “Add configuration” button. Hover to view descriptions of existing attributes. Use IntelliSense to learn about possible attributes. By default, it contains the following content: You can also create it via Run> Add Configuration and select Node.js. Press create a launch.json and select Node.js in the prompt to create a launch.json configurations file. You can also run the app on a terminal using the -inspect flag like this node -inspect. To start the debugging process, press the Run and Debug button on the debug panel and select Node.js if prompted. This is where you will view the debug logs. Switch to the debug console using Ctrl+Shift+Y or by pressing “Debug Console”. In the “Run” tab, there are 2 options, Run and Debug and Node.js Debug Terminal.Ĭlick “Node.js Debug Terminal” to open the built-in terminal. In the “Breakpoints” panel you can activate and deactivate your breakpoints using the checkboxes. If no prior configurations have been made, there are 2 tabs in the debug panel. You can also press Ctrl+Shift+D to open the same panel. Open the debug panel by clicking the bug icon on the activity bar. You can place them in between suspected regions or randomly if you have no idea where the bug is hiding. Breakpoints will aid in identifying the line or region where your code is failing. ![]() A red dot will appear when a breakpoint has been set. Do this by clicking on the left side of the line numbers where you would like your code to stop. Next, open the Node.js file you want to debug and set some breakpoints. You can look for an Auto Attach: On statement at the bottom blue bar in VS Code to confirm. This will always be enabled for Node.js applications from now on. On the left side under Extensions, click Node debug. You can also open the Command Palette ( Ctrl+Shift+P) and type Preferences: Open Settings(UI), or find the gear icon in the lower left corner of the interface. #Visual studio code js debugger download#If not, download the latest version from here. and has made debugging Node.js apps a very simple and straightforward process.īefore proceeding, make sure you have the VS Code editor installed on your computer. VS Code can also be used to debug many languages like Python, JavaScript, etc. ![]() Its features can be further enhanced by the use of extensions. Visual Studio Code (VS Code) is a code editor made by Microsoft that is used by developers worldwide due to the many tools and features it offers. But, what if I were to tell you there is a simpler method? In this article, we will be looking at how you can use VS Code to debug a Node.js application. It often involves putting console.log on every corner of your code. It has been the default JavaScript debugger in Visual Studio Code since 1.46 (we're now at v1.58) and is even being rolled out into the Visual Studio IDE.Debugging Node.js code can prove challenging for many people. That built-in experience comes via vscode-js-debug, a GitHub project described as a Debugger Adapter Protocol-based JavaScript debugger that works with Node.js, Chrome, Edge, WebView2 and VS Code extensions. The company's Edge browser development team recently announced that JavaScript developers in VS Code can now uninstall the Debugger for Chrome and/or the Debugger for Edge extensions for a new, simplified debugging experience. Microsoft has created a built-in JavaScript debugger for Visual Studio Code, the wildly popular, open source-based, cross-platform code editor.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|